description abstractEstimates of cloud-top pressure and effective fractional cloud cover may be retrieved from satellite infrared sounder data. This paper presents the results of a simulation study which provides some insights into the relative performance of different retrieval methods and of different combinations of spectral channels. The ?minimum residual method,? a variant of a technique described previously by other authors, is presented. It is applied here to groups of HIRS-2 channels and some aspects of its performance for different combinations of channels are examined using simulated data. It is also compared with the ?radiance rationing method.? Calculations suggest that the minimum residual method is comparable in performance to the radiance rationing method for high cloud but better for midlevel cloud. The relationship (and relative performance) of these methods to that used operationally to assign pressures to cloud tracers in Meteosat data is also discussed. The methods presented are for retrieving cloud parameters alone and have practical applications as such. However, they may also be used as a means of obtaining first-guess cloud parameters within satellite sounding inversion schemes which retrieve simultaneously atmospheric temperature and humidity profiles along with cloud and surface parameters.
